So what can you do to stay on track?
- Most importantly, accept that while these behavior changes will be difficult and different, you have to create a plan that doesn’t make you feel constantly deprived. If we are relying on willpower, it is not going to work in the long run.
- Set yourself for success. All the time, but especially the weekends. Look at menus before you go to restaurants, eat some protein and fat before you leave the house so you do not walk into a social event starving and have some snacks in your bag/car so you are always prepared.
- A weight loss plan likely includes decreasing your alcohol consumption. Not eliminating, but decreasing. Consider not drinking as much as you are used to or as much as everyone else. I know it is difficult at first but you would be amazed how much it is simply a habit. Next time, have one less drink than normal and see how it goes.
- Go ahead and reward yourself! Just find something that will not sabotage your health and wellness goals. Get a massage, go for a hike, buy that goodie you have had your eye on – do anything to keep you moving forward.
